Birds Nest Treats for Easter

I love this easy and delicious Easter treat I found on the Tip Junkie.  Make these for your next Easter party or brunch and your guests will love the yummy treats! Here’s how to make these cute masterpieces.

Step 1:
You’ll need 3 ingredients plus a cookie sheet and parchment paper.

12oz bag of Chow Mein Noodles
12oz bag of butterscotch morsels
1 bag of mini Cadbury eggs

Step 2:
Melt the butterscotch morsels in the microwave for 30 second increments. Stir and then reheat until they are all melted. If it dries out, just add some vegetable oil and mix.
Step3:
Mix the melted butterscotch with the Chow Mein noodles until the noodles are coated with the butterscotch.
Step 4:
Line a cookie sheet with parchment paper
Step 5:
Grab your 1/4 cup measuring spoon and start scooping out the noodles and put them onto your cookie sheet.
Step 6:
Decorate your nest with the mini Cadbury eggs!
